PE Global is recruiting for a Project Manager for a leading multinational Biotech client based in Limerick.
This is an initial 12-month contract, fully onsite role.
Summary: Project Manager to lead, coordinate and deliver CAPEX project on-site in Limerick supporting and optimizing throughout.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following:
Project Planning, Execution & Monitoring
- Develop and execute project plans, timelines, budgets, and resource allocations for large- scale biopharma CAPEX projects.
- Oversee the design, construction, and commissioning phases of biopharma facilities, ensuring alignment with project goals.
- Proactive drive Safety and Quality focus throughout project lifecycle.
- Track project milestones and ensure timely delivery of all phases.
- Prepare and present regular progress updates to senior management and stakeholders.
Stakeholder Management
- Act as the primary point of contact for internal teams, contractors, technical consultants, and regulatory bodies.
- Ensure effective communicationand collaboration between cross-functionalteams, including engineering, procurement, and qualityassurance.
Budget and Financial
- Manage project budgets, ensuring cost control and adherence to financial target.
- Prepare regular financial reports and forecasts for stakeholders and senior management.
Team Leadership
- Lead and motivate multidisciplinary teams, ensuring alignment with project objectives.
- Mentor and provide guidance to team.
Regulatory Compliance
- Maintains company reputation by enforcing compliance with all relevant laws, policies and regulations.
Risk Management
- Identify risks and implement mitigation strategies to ensure project success.
- Conduct regular risk assessments and update stakeholders on potential issues.
